Preamble: We run tourneys that have entry fees. We use standard payout percentages but, occasionally, the top two or three players will agree to chop.

When the last 2 players decided to chop the pot, I took the tournament offline to end it and chop. The players were refunded their entry fees. Is there a way to have it not do that, or do I just have to manually make the adjustment? Am I facilitating the chop incorrectly?

You'll have to manually make the adjustment. Currently there is no player-agreed-upon chop option. Just the "Stop on chop" option which basically duplicates a Fifty-50 tournament that PokerStars has, where the tournament automatically stops once the remaining payout percentages are all equal.
